July 4th Fruit Pizza Pie for a crowd


Ingredients:


Sugar Cookie Crust:

  • 1 1/2 cups sugar

  • 2 1/2 cups flour

  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der

  • 1/2 teaspoons salt

  • 1 cup butter, softened

  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ract

  • 2 large eggs

Cream Cheese Frosting:

*NOTE: If you don't need to pipe frosting onto your pie as part of your chosen decoration, then half these ingredients for the cream cheese frosting. You'll have enough to cover the pie in a nice healthy layer of frosting with half the recipe. I used the recipe below because half went as my base layer and I used the other half to make decorations with on the pie.*

  • 24 ounces cream cheese, softened

  • 1/2 cup butter, softened

  • 2 teaspoon vanilla

  • 2 1/2 cup powdered sugar

Fruit Topping:

*NOTE: Use whatever fruit your heart desires to match your decoration.*

  • 3 packs of Raspberries

  • 1 pack of Blueberries

Instructions:

  1. First mix your wet ingredients that include the softened butter, sugar, egg, and vanilla until well combined.

  2. Add your dry ingredients to the wet which include your flour, baking powder, and salt. Mix until combined.

  3. Scoop dough into a log or a ball. Chill your dough in the refrigerator for 30 minutes.

  4. While your dough is chilling.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.

  5. Grease a 14-inch pizza pan or round baking stone.

  6. Roll the chilled dough out onto the pan or stone. Allow it to rest for a couple minutes.

  7. Bake in the oven for about 20 minutes or less if you start to see browned edges.

  8. While the cookie crust is baking, use an electric mixer, and combine the room temperature cream cheese, butter, powdered sugar and vanilla until smooth and creamy.

  9. Allow the cookie crust to cool for about 30 minutes or till cool to the touch.

  10. Spread half of the frosting over the cooled cookie crust and the other half can be used for piping.

  11. Chill again for 30 minutes to firm up.

  12. Top with fruit!
